
It is important to be aware of the colours that you wear when you present yourself to clients, your boss, coworkers or in the social environment. There is always a message behind the colour that you wear. In other words, it has a psychological affect on your client and how they are going to react to you.It is amazing what positive effect this will have on your mission in “dressing for success”.
- Business Colours – RED, BLUE, BLACK, WHITE, CREAM, PURPLE, GREEN, BEIDGE & DARK BROWNS (In the corporate and business world, be careful of revealing outfits and outfits that do not fit your body shape!)
- Fun & Feminine Colours – (Socialising musts – not for business and selling purposes) – PINK,YELLOW, PASTEL COLOURS, ORANGE & LIGHT BROWNS.
- Stay away from large prints on your blouses, shirts and jackets e.g. flowers, stripes and polka dots as this may distract client or coworkers from presentations and selling pitches.
- Wearing the right colours, patterns and lines for the right occasion, business meeting, interview, or presentation can form an important part of your success.
- Make sure that you are well-groomed – use perfume and some makeup, even if it is just a bit of lipgloss, foundation & face powder.
- Have fun! Mix and match your colours as this may “speak”of self-confidence and a positive self-esteem.
- Wear appropriate accessories like jewelry, scarves & shoes with your outfit (Do not wear “tekkies” or “flip flops”in a business or corporate environment).
- It is advisable to know your undertone e.g. is it cool or warm? Wearing a colour with the wrong undertone may make you look tired, old, fatter and form “shades”on your face that brings out blemishes and marks.
